In today’s travel industry, customer expectations are higher than ever. Agencies can no longer rely on spreadsheets or generic tools to manage leads, bookings, and supplier relationships. What they need is a dedicated CRM designed for the travel industry — one that understands the unique workflows of tour operators, OTAs, and travel agents.

A travel CRM for agencies goes beyond simple contact management. It provides lead pipelines, automated quotes, booking builder tools, and seamless supplier API integrations. Instead of wasting time switching between systems, agencies can manage everything from one dashboard — web, mobile, and admin.

The benefits are clear: faster response times, higher customer satisfaction, and better visibility into sales. Agencies that adopt CRM technology often see measurable improvements in conversion rates and repeat bookings. With automated reminders and WhatsApp/email notifications, no inquiry ever gets lost.
